Utah Code § 63G-6a-902

Cancellation and rejection of bids and proposals

Amended by Chapter 257, 2020 General Session

(1) An issuing procurement unit may cancel an invitation for bids, a request for proposals, or other solicitation or reject any or all bids or proposal responses, in whole or in part, as may be specified in the solicitation, when it is in the best interests of the procurement unit in accordance with the rules of the rulemaking authority.

(2) The reasons for a cancellation or rejection described in Subsection (1) shall be made part of the contract file.
